This patch set adds support for __read_mostly - a separate section
which is used to hold data which is hardly ever written.

The idea behind this feature is to reduce the amount of cache line
bouncing between SMP cores by avoiding this data sharing cache lines
with data which is written more frequently.  As long as a cache line
is not dirtied, several cores can keep a copy of the data in their
caches.
